Transmission errors. Ford error codes

P0730

Gearbox adjustment problems.

 

P0731

Incorrectly adjusted first gear.

 

P0732

Error adjusting second gear.

 

P0733

Code P0733 indicates an incorrect third gear ratio. Transmission control unit diagnostics required.

 

P0734

The fourth gear of the gearbox is incorrectly adjusted.

 

P0771

Failure of solenoid E.

 

P0766

Code P0766 reports the failure of solenoid D.

 

P0783

Problems switching third and fourth gears.

 

P0816

Weakening of transfer, malfunction of the switch of a box. Detailed transmission diagnostics for mechanical damage are required.

 

P0896

Failure of the microprocessor transmission control module.

 

P0904

Error selecting box range. Usually the problem is with the transmission control module.

 

P287A

Clutch jamming in the state of adhesion.

 

P0919

Code 0919 reports a gear shift chain error.

 

P0909

Faulty actuator or transmission drawbar mechanism. Diagnosis of a fork of a transmission is required, breakage of its mechanical component is possible.

 

P0919

Robotic gearbox malfunction (work). You need to check all the contacts of the unit, as well as the transmission control unit.

 

P170A

Clutch switch failure. With the appearance of error P170A you need to diagnose the connector on the device, as well as make sure as a contact.

 

P193B

No signal from the accelerator pedal or throttle. Requires cleaning and diagnosis of the latter.

 

P0949

Adaptation of the control unit of the transmission unit is not completed. It is necessary to check the operation of the module, in particular its connection to the power supply circuit.

 

P0972

Code 0972 indicates a malfunction of solenoid A.

 

P0702

Gearbox control module malfunction. The error may be accompanied by jerks with increasing speed. You need to check the operation of the transmission unit, as well as make sure that the device receives power.

 

P0981

Damage to the transmission solenoid valve control.

 

P1545

The throttle control unit does not respond to the accelerator pedal.

 

P07A5

An error indicates that the transmission clutch is stuck. A complete disassembly and disassembly of the transmission is required to correct the problem.

 

P073F

Unable to engage first gear. Most likely, the problem is related to the operation of the transmission control unit, but may be a fork gearshift.

 

P07A3

Faulty friction elements of the box. Disassembly and complete disassembly of the unit are required to eliminate the problem.

 

P073E

Transmission unit error due to reverse gear engagement. You need to check the operation of the module.

 

P090C

Error 090C or P090C indicates a low signal level from the clutch drive. You need to check the operation of the sensor mounted on the pedal.

 

P061B

Transmission control unit malfunction, internal error.

 

P1608

The high pressure pump control module is defective. If code 1608 appears, check the contacts and wires of the unit. Error P1608 may be due to damage to the insulation on the power cord.

 

5750

Accelerator pedal position error. In fact, such a problem is usually associated with the sensor.

 

P1709

Box switch failure or malfunction. With the advent of code P1709 it is necessary to diagnose the transmission selector.

 

P1712, P1719

Literally, the code is deciphered as the momentum of the request to reduce the torque in the transmission. Error P1712 or P1719 refers to faults in the control unit. If there are no changes in the operation of the car, you can simply reset the code.

 

P1744

Malfunction of the torque converter clutch, the device is switched off in the Off position. There is a mechanical problem, you need to check the box.

 

P1174

Code 1174, P1174 or P117400 reports an error in the position of the cam washer.

 

P1750

Adaptive clutch programming procedure not performed.

 

P1793

Box failure. With the appearance of the code P1793, the control module of the car can not determine the transmission unit.

 

P1780

No connection to the transmission control module. The P1780 transmission may not work properly. Thrust reduction is possible. With the advent of code 1780, the integrity of the wires coming from the transmission control unit should be diagnosed.

 

P2700, P2701

Error in the operation of the transmission unit.

 

P1812

General malfunction of the transmission unit.

 

P1934

Lack of information about the speed of the car. The cause of the P1934 problem should be found in the operation of the controller mounted on the gearbox and the control unit.

 

P2786

The combination reports an elevated temperature of the gearshift actuator. You need to check the operation of the module.

 

P2831, P2832, P2836, P2837, P2338

Gear shift plug malfunction. The error usually occurs on "Americans" and "Europeans" equipped with a robotic gearbox.

 

P2787

Elevated clutch system temperature. This problem usually occurs as a result of wear on the clutch discs or the bearing. In the presence of mechanical damage, as well as signs of wear, the elements must be replaced.

 

P2795

General box failure error. Diagnosis of the transmission unit as well as the module that controls it is required.

 

P2004

Jamming of the valve of the geometry of the intake manifold in the open position.
